Most Affordable Neighborhoods in Greenville, NC

Some of the cheapest neighborhoods in Greenville are River Park North, North Carolina Northeast Area, and Southeast Greenville. These neighborhoods offer some of the lowest rent prices in Greenville, making them ideal for renters on a budget. As of April 23, 2025, the average rent in Greenville is $926, which is 0.6% lower than last year. However, it's important to remember that rental prices can vary significantly based on factors such as location, amenities, and floor plans.

When you’re looking for a great Greenville neighborhood on a budget, check out Southeast Greenville. The average rent is $998, compared to the city average of $926. Rent prices have increased by 0.6%. Southeast Greenville is convenient to Village Square, Pitt-Greenville, and East Carolina University. The community is somewhat walkable with a WalkScore® of 53.

Southwest Greenville is an affordable neighborhood in Greenville with an average rent price of $1,026. Compare this to the city average of $926. In the past year, rent prices have increased by 1.3%. Southwest Greenville provides easy access to East Carolina University, Red Oak Plaza, and East Carolina University. It’s a car-dependent neighborhood with a WalkScore® of 39.
